Please check the settings in the CodeRabbit UI or the You can disable this status message by setting the 📝 WalkthroughWalkthroughThis change implements a major schema and API refactor, replacing the previous agent-centric model with a platform account-centric model. It introduces new database entities and enums, updates API endpoints to align with the new structure, removes legacy agent and person logic, and migrates all relevant foreign keys and validation logic to use platform accounts and identifiers. :⚠️ Potential issueCritical: Access control table should have restricted permissions.
The
SpaceAccess
table controls authorization, yet grantsALL
permissions to anonymous users. This could allow unauthorized users to grant themselves access to spaces.Implement strict access controls:
-GRANT ALL ON TABLE public."SpaceAccess" TO anon; +-- Anonymous users should not have any access to the access control table GRANT ALL ON TABLE public."SpaceAccess" TO authenticated; GRANT ALL ON TABLE public."SpaceAccess" TO service_role;packages/database/schema.yaml (1)

apps/website/app/api/supabase/agent_identifier/route.ts (1)
29-30
: Specify radix parameter for parseInt.When using
parseInt
, always specify the radix parameter to avoid unexpected behavior with strings starting with "0".- if (!account_id || Number.isNaN(Number.parseInt(account_id))) + if (!account_id || Number.isNaN(Number.parseInt(account_id, 10)))apps/website/app/api/supabase/platform_account/route.ts (2)
